Boat-tailed Grackle In Peninsular Florida

Boat-tailed Grackle in Peninsular Florida has declined: down 49% on the route-weighted index since 1968.

Forecast

If the recent trend holds, Boat-tailed Grackle in Peninsular Florida is projected to rise about 18% by 2029 — from 14 in 2024 to a central estimate of 17 (95% range 0.00–37). A 5-year backtest shows a typical error of ±38.2%, with 100% of held-out values landing inside the 95% band.
